Best 80 Watt Soldering Iron For Electronics FAQs
1. What should I look for in an 80W soldering iron for electronics?
Focus on temperature control, ergonomic design, tip compatibility, and heating speed.
2. Is 80W too powerful for small electronics work?
No — with adjustable heat and proper technique, 80 W is versatile for both small and larger electronics tasks.
3. Do I need extra tips?
Yes — having a variety of tips (chisel, conical, bevel) helps handle diverse components.
4. Can I solder surface‑mount devices with an 80W iron?
Yes, if you use the correct lower heat setting and fine tip.
5. How often should I clean the tip?
Clean before and after each session to ensure good heat transfer and joint quality.
6. Should I use solder with flux core?
Flux‑core solder improves wetting and flow, which is ideal for electronics.
7. Are digital displays necessary?
Not necessary, but digital readouts can help with precise temperature control.
